EBU, Eurofins partner on UHDTV standards

Specification covers 4K, HDR, Wider Colour Gamut and Next Generation Audio

The European Broadcasting Union and Eurofins have partnered to publish a set of key distribution parameters (EBU Tech 3372) for Ultra High Definition Television (UHDTV) video and audio.

The EBU specification covers several aspects of UHDTV: higher resolution (4K), High Dynamic Range (HDR), Wider Colour Gamut (WCG) and Next Generation Audio (NGA).

Eurofins has created a certification logo, referencing the EBU specification, which manufacturers will be permitted to use for TV sets that have been tested to be interoperable with television signals matching the EBU’s specification.

The logo aims to give broadcasters more planning security when choosing UHDTV parameters for their services; and consumers the security of purchasing a TV set that will allow them to take full advantage of the broadcasters’ existing and future high quality immersive TV services for years to come.

EBU director of technology and innovation, Antonio Arcidiacono said, “With the current multiplicity of options it became clear that our Members needed a stable and secure specification for their UHDTV planning strategies. The collaboration with Eurofins ensures that the broadcast signal parameters are matched by receiving technologies provided by CE device manufacturers.”
